评估定量和定性风险信息可视化对理解假设基于风险的乳腺癌查结果的影响

概括
与文本相比,可视化并没有改善对乳腺癌查风险信息的理解. 了解挑战仍然存在,特别是对于非平均风险类别,无论信息格式如何.

背景情况:
- 基于风险的乳腺癌查结果的有效沟通对于知情决策至关重要.
- 视觉化越来越多地被探索,以提高对复杂健康信息的理解.
- 之前的研究表明,不同通信格式的有效性各不相同.
研究的目的:
- 评估视觉辅助工具 (图标阵列,图纸) 与纯文本格式相比,能否提高对乳腺癌风险信息的理解.
- 评估不同信息格式 (文本与数字,文本与可视化,交互) 对理解数值和定性风险数据的影响.
- 检查乳腺癌风险类别如何影响理解.
主要方法:
- 一个在线实验,包括1047名来自荷兰普通人口的40-74岁的女性.
- 一个主体间的设计,有三个信息格式 (文字与数字,文本与风险可视化,交互式) 和四个风险类别 (略有下降,平均,略有增加,增加).
- 主要结果测量了对数值和定性风险信息的字面和基本理解.
主要成果:
- 在"带有风险可视化的文本"和"带有数字的文本"格式之间,没有发现理解的显著差异.
- 与"文字与数字"格式相比",交互式"格式显示数字和定性风险信息的字面理解程度较差.
- 不属于平均风险类别的参与者对文字和基本内容的理解能力较差.
结论:
- 与标准文本格式相比,测试的可视化图像并没有提高对基于风险的乳腺癌查结果的理解.
- 了解复杂的风险信息仍然是一个挑战,特别是在平均风险类别之外的个人.
- 未来的研究应该探索替代或改进的可视化策略,并考虑个体在风险感知和识字方面的差异.
